Hajjiabad-e Seyyedeh ( Persian: حاجي آباد سيده, also Romanized as Ḩājjīābād-e Seyyedeh; also known as Ḩājjīābād) [1] is a village in Chaharduli-ye Gharbi Rural District, Chaharduli District, Qorveh County, Kurdistan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 103, in 29 families. [2] The village is populated by Kurds. [3]
